In Boston, Massachusetts, the older housing stock presents unique challenges for HVAC installation. Many homes have limited space for ductwork, and older foundations can be tricky. Professionals working in areas like Beacon Hill or the South End are experienced with these situations. They know how to integrate modern systems into historic buildings without compromising charm or structure. This often means exploring options like ductless mini-splits or carefully planned central air installations. The pros understand the local climate and the need for reliable heating in winter and cooling in summer. They can assess your home's specific needs, considering insulation, window types, and layout. When you look at the cost of a new HVAC system, several variables come into play. The size of your home and the necessary cooling or heating capacity—measured in tons—are the biggest factors. You also have to consider the efficiency rating of the unit, the complexity of your existing ductwork, and whether you need to upgrade electrical components to support a modern system. Labor requirements, including accessibility and permit fees, further influence the final number.
